Come utilizzare dist-upgrade in Ubuntu: Guida completa per aggiornamenti di sistema sicuri ed efficienti

1. Cos’è Ubuntu dist-upgrade?

Ubuntu dist-upgrade è uno dei comandi essenziali utilizzati per mantenere un sistema Ubuntu aggiornato. A differenza di un normale upgrade, dist-upgrade non solo aggiorna i pacchetti ma gestisce anche gli aggiornamenti del kernel e i pacchetti con dipendenze complesse. In particolare, può rimuovere automaticamente i pacchetti non necessari e risolvere i conflitti di dipendenze all’interno del sistema.

Perché usare “dist-upgrade”?

Ci sono diversi modi per aggiornare Ubuntu, ma dist-upgrade è particolarmente potente. Mentre un upgrade regolare aggiorna principalmente le versioni esistenti dei pacchetti, dist-upgrade installa pacchetti appena richiesti quando vengono introdotte dipendenze aggiuntive. Rimuove anche i pacchetti di dipendenza obsoleti, aiutando a mantenere la stabilità complessiva del sistema.

Ad esempio, quando viene rilasciata una nuova versione del kernel, l’esecuzione di dist-upgrade aggiorna automaticamente il kernel, migliorando la sicurezza e le prestazioni del sistema.

2. Perché gli Aggiornamenti di Versione di Ubuntu Sono Importanti

Ci sono molteplici ragioni per aggiornare il tuo sistema Ubuntu, tra cui:

  1. Sicurezza Migliorata : Nuove patch di sicurezza e correzioni per vulnerabilità proteggono il sistema da minacce esterne.
  2. Correzioni di Bug : I problemi e i difetti esistenti vengono risolti, migliorando la stabilità del sistema.
  3. Nuove Funzionalità : Il supporto per l’ultima versione di software e hardware viene aggiunto nelle versioni più recenti.
  4. Miglioramenti delle Prestazioni : Le prestazioni del sistema possono aumentare grazie a miglioramenti dell’efficienza.

Per questi motivi, si raccomandano aggiornamenti regolari del sistema per gli utenti Ubuntu.

3. Cosa Fare Prima dell’Aggiornamento

Prima di aggiornare Ubuntu, sono richiesti diversi passaggi importanti di preparazione. Il più cruciale è creare un backup per proteggere il tuo sistema e i dati.

Creare un Backup

Poiché un aggiornamento può causare problemi imprevisti, è fortemente raccomandato eseguire il backup dei seguenti elementi in anticipo:

  • Sistema Intero : Creare un backup completo dell’immagine del sistema ti permette di ripristinare il sistema facilmente se si verificano problemi.
  • Dati Utente : Assicurati di eseguire il backup dei file e dei dati di configurazione dalla tua directory home.

Aggiornare l’Elenco dei Pacchetti

Prima di aggiornare, assicurati che tutti i pacchetti esistenti siano aggiornati. Per fare ciò, esegui i seguenti comandi:

sudo apt update
sudo apt upgrade

Questo passaggio garantisce che l’elenco dei tuoi pacchetti sia attuale e previene problemi durante il processo di aggiornamento.

4. Come Eseguire l’Aggiornamento di Versione

Aggiornamento Usando la Riga di Comando

Puoi aggiornare Ubuntu dalla CLI (Command Line Interface) con facilità. Segui questi passaggi per aggiornare il tuo sistema:

  1. Aggiorna l’elenco dei pacchetti sudo apt update
  2. Aggiorna il sistema sudo apt dist-upgrade
  3. Rimuovi pacchetti non necessari sudo apt autoremove

Questa sequenza aggiorna l’intero sistema, aggiorna il kernel e i pacchetti dipendenti, e rimuove i pacchetti non più necessari.

Aggiornamento via GUI

Se preferisci non usare la riga di comando, puoi aggiornare attraverso la GUI. Dalle impostazioni di Ubuntu “Software & Updates”, abilita le notifiche di aggiornamento per le nuove versioni.

5. Checklist Post-Aggiornamento

Dopo che l’aggiornamento è completato, verifica che il tuo sistema funzioni correttamente.

Verifica il Nuovo Kernel

Per confermare che il nuovo kernel è installato, esegui:

uname -r

Se la versione del kernel visualizzata corrisponde alla versione aggiornata, tutto sta funzionando come previsto.

Rimuovi Pacchetti Non Necessari

Potrebbero rimanere pacchetti non necessari dopo l’aggiornamento. Rimuovili usando:

sudo apt autoremove

Questo aiuta a conservare spazio di archiviazione e previene sprechi di risorse.

6. Problemi Comuni e Soluzioni

Ecco alcuni problemi comuni che possono verificarsi durante o dopo un aggiornamento.

Conflitti di Pacchetti

I conflitti di pacchetti possono sorgere durante il processo di aggiornamento. In tali casi, identifica i pacchetti conflittuali e intraprendi l’azione appropriata. Puoi cercare soluzioni online basate sul messaggio di errore.

Conflitti di File di Configurazione

I file di configurazione possono anche entrare in conflitto durante l’aggiornamento. Quando appare il seguente tipo di messaggio, procedi con cautela:

Configuration file '/etc/cloud/cloud.cfg'

Segui attentamente le opzioni visualizzate per risolvere correttamente la situazione.

7. Conclusione

Questo articolo ha spiegato come aggiornare il tuo sistema usando il comando dist-upgrade in Ubuntu. Gli aggiornamenti regolari aiutano a mantenere la sicurezza, le prestazioni e l’accesso alle ultime funzionalità. Esegui sempre un backup prima di aggiornare per evitare perdite di dati.

Mantieni il tuo sistema aggiornato per garantire un ambiente Ubuntu sicuro, stabile e ottimizzato.